Official abstract text for this publication.
A method and an apparatus are provided for transmitting a Power Headroom Report (PHR) to base station by a User Equipment (UE), wherein the UE determines whether a received an uplink resource is a first uplink resource allocated for a new transmission after a Medium Access Control (MAC) reset, and starts a timer for reporting the PHR, if the allocated uplink resource is the first uplink resource allocated for the new transmission after the MAC reset.

What is claimed is: 1. A method by a user equipment (UE) in a wireless communication system, the method comprising: stopping a timer, when a medium access control (MAC) reset is performed; identifying whether a first uplink resource for a new transmission is first allocated from a base station (BS) since the MAC reset is performed; if the first uplink resource for the new transmission is first allocated since the MAC reset is performed, starting the stopped timer, without transmitting a power headroom report (PHR); triggering a PHR if the started timer expires; identifying that a second uplink resource for another new transmission is allocated from the base station; transmitting, to the base station, the triggered PHR using the second uplink resource; and starting the expired timer. 2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the PHR is transmitted using the second uplink resource after the new transmission using the first uplink resource. 3. The method of claim 2 , wherein the new transmission transmits a control message using the first uplink resource, and wherein the control message comprises information related to a handover of the user equipment to a target base station. 4. The method of claim 1 , wherein the timer is a periodic timer for generation of the PHR by the user equipment. 5. The method of claim 1 , wherein the MAC reset is performed due to a handover to a target cell by the user equipment. 6.
